Lua error in package.lua at line 80: module 'strict' not found. Lynda Tait Randle, alto singer of southern gospel music, was born in 1962 and grew up in the inner city of Washington, DC.

Gaither Homecoming

Randle is most well known as a Gaither Homecoming artist and markets a number of singing videos[1] featuring her mellow alto voice in gospel music, particularly southern gospel.

Other outreach

She also heads Lynda Randle Ministries in Kansas City, Missouri. Randle on 2009 March 21 became one of the main artists featured by Feed the Children as a fundraising solicitation for contributions.[2]

Personal life

Randle lives in Kansas City, Missouri, with her husband Michael Randle and two daughters Patience and Joy.[3] Randle has four sisters. Her brother is Michael Tait of dc Talk and Newsboys.[citation needed]
